中文摘要As an interconnector of solid oxide fuel cell, La1-xCaxCrO3(x = 0.0 similar to 0.5) were prepared by sol-gel method. The crystal structures of La1-xCaxCrO3 at room temperature are the orthorhombic perovskite GdFeO3-type. XPS analysis indicates that chrome ions are in different valence state. The introduction of Ca2+ into the lattice induces the oxidation of Cr3+ to Cr6+. With x increasing, the amount of Cr6+ increases. The present of the more Cr6+ is one of the important factors that effect electric conductivity of La1-xCaxCrO3.
